Assange’s legal battles have been ongoing for years, with the Australian journalist facing extradition to the United States on charges related to his role in publishing classified government documents through WikiLeaks. The plea deal offered by the DoJ would see Assange released from custody after serving his time, bringing an end to a high-profile case that has sparked global debate on freedom of the press and government transparency.
